Best Zipline Courses for Photographers Seeking Sun‑Glare Effects

Ziplining is thrilling, but for photographers, it's also a moving canvas. Some courses offer perfect opportunities to capture the dynamic interplay of light, sun, and scenery. Sun‑glare, or lens flare, can transform ordinary shots into dramatic, ethereal images when handled with care. Here's a guide to the best zipline courses around the world where photographers can chase those luminous effects.

Costa Verde Canopy -- Costa Rica

Set amidst lush rainforests and misty valleys, Costa Verde Canopy provides sweeping views of the morning sun rising over tropical peaks. Early morning rides are ideal for sun-glare photography.

Photography Highlights:

  • Golden Hour Opportunities : Sunrise glints off dewy leaves, creating natural lens flare.
  • Elevated Perspectives : High lines over valleys allow shots of sun filtering through the canopy.
  • Mist + Sun Effects : The combination of fog and light produces dreamy, atmospheric flares.

Pro tip: Position yourself so the sun is slightly off-center in the frame for balanced glare.

Andes Sky Zipline -- Chile

High in the Andes, this zipline runs across craggy peaks with unobstructed sunlight. Photographers can play with the sun behind mountains, generating bold starburst effects.

Photography Highlights:

  • Backlit Mountain Views : Sun behind peaks creates dramatic silhouettes with glare accents.
  • Reflective Surfaces : Snow patches and streams enhance reflective lens flares.
  • Dynamic Motion Shots: Capture yourself or others mid-ride against radiant skies.

A polarizing filter can help control overexposure while retaining flare artistry.

Amazon Flight Canopy -- Peru

Over the Peruvian Amazon, dense forest canopies and meandering rivers create unique light interactions. Sunlight piercing through leaves produces striking dappled sun-glare effects.

Photography Highlights:

  • Leaf-Cut Light Beams : Sun shining through gaps creates natural lens flare streaks.
  • Water Reflections : Rivers reflect sunlight into unpredictable glint patterns.
  • Canopy Depth : Layers of foliage with sun glare produce a three-dimensional effect.

Shooting with a wide-angle lens captures both flare and the vastness of the rainforest.

Table Mountain Zipline -- South Africa

While not in South America, this course is legendary for photographers chasing sun-glare. The combination of cliffside lines and ocean horizons is perfect for dramatic light effects.

Photography Highlights:

  • Ocean Sunsets : Capture flares over the horizon as the sun dips into the sea.
  • Cliff Edge Dynamics : Sun peeking over jagged edges creates sharp, graphic lens flare.
  • Vivid Color Contrast : Bright glare against dark rock or vegetation amplifies depth.

Golden hour rides are recommended for the most intense visual impact.

Pura Vida Zipline -- Brazil

In Brazil's Atlantic Forest, the Pura Vida Zipline runs through tropical foliage with occasional breaks to reveal river valleys. Midday sun and canopy gaps provide intermittent glare bursts.

Photography Highlights:

  • Sun Filtering Through Trees : Sporadic patches of bright light produce soft flare effects.
  • Action Shots with Light Play: Capture riders against sun-saturated backgrounds.
  • Layered Foliage : Foreground leaves partially block sun, producing natural flare patterns.

Use manual exposure to prevent the flare from washing out details.

Skyline Adventure -- New Zealand

Another global highlight, this course combines alpine ridges with long stretches of open sky, ideal for lens flare experimentation.

Photography Highlights:

  • Open Sky Sun Flares : Long, unobstructed lines create elongated glare streaks.
  • Cloud + Sun Interaction : Partially cloudy skies add variation to flare intensity.
  • Aerial Motion Effects : Capture dynamic flare with riders swooping through sunlight patches.

Consider shooting at different angles to experiment with varying flare shapes.

Tips for Capturing Sun-Glare on Ziplines

  1. Angle Wisely : Position the camera so the sun is just outside or slightly in the frame to control flare shape.
  2. Use Lens Hoods Sparingly : Sometimes removing the hood allows natural flare that enhances the image.
  3. Experiment with Filters : Neutral density or polarizing filters help manage exposure without eliminating flare entirely.
  4. Ride Timing: Early morning or late afternoon provides softer sun angles, reducing harsh highlights.
  5. Safety First : Always prioritize harness security over perfect framing. Handheld or GoPro mounts work best.

Photographers chasing sun-glare effects will find these zipline courses a perfect blend of adventure and light artistry. From tropical rainforests to alpine ridges, soaring above stunning landscapes while capturing radiant sunlight transforms ordinary zipline shots into cinematic, magical imagery.
